The local landscape around Queanbeyan is abundant with native greenery and eucalyptus trees which function as the natural environment for numerous aggressive termite types. When metropolitan advancement encroaches on these natural surroundings, the termites typically transition from foraging on fallen logs to seeking out the skilled wood found within the structure of regional houses. Due to the fact that these bugs travel through underground mud tunnels, they can bypass lots of traditional barriers to get in a home through the tiniest fractures in a concrete slab or by means of the subfloor. Once they develop a course into the structure, they work all the time to take in cellulose, which is the main element of wood.
Effective termite management in Queanbeyan generally begins with a thorough evaluation, sticking to rigid nationwide guidelines. Proficient specialists employ advanced devices, consisting of moisture detectors, infrared cams, and sound sensors, to locate termite activity in concealed locations such as wall cavities and subfloor areas. This initial assessment is vital, as it exposes the scope of the infestation and determine the exact termite species present. Considered that particular termite species are more harmful than others, accurate identification is important to inform the advancement of a customized treatment plan, whether using baiting systems or chemical applications, to remove the entire termite colony, not just the specific termites presently infesting the home.
In this region, an extremely successful method to termite control is the production of a chemical barrier in the soil. This is accomplished by injecting a specialized termite-killing liquid into the soil surrounding the structure of a building. The modern chemicals used in this technique are undetected to termites, allowing them to unwittingly enter contact with the substance as they move through the cured area. The termites then carry the chemical back to their colony, ultimately leading to the demise of the queen and the entire nest. Nevertheless, for structures with intricate building or ecological concerns that make liquid barriers impractical, an alternative solution is readily available. This includes setting up termite baiting and tracking systems, which consist of strategically placed stations around the perimeter of the home that catch termites as they forage, preventing them from reaching the main structure.
For Queanbeyan residents, regular upkeep is crucial to protect their residential check here or commercial properties. A one-time treatment is typically insufficient, as the surrounding bushland continuously presents a danger. Modifications in seasons and intense rains can compromise soil barriers and create vulnerabilities in garden beds adjacent to walls. To guarantee optimal security, annual check-ups by professionals are highly recommended, allowing them to determine possible concerns quickly and provide assistance on mitigating moisture and eliminating appealing conditions, such as debris and raw material, near the residential or commercial property's foundation.
In addition to the actual treatment procedure, Termite Treatment Queanbeyan also positions a strong focus on education and awareness. Locals are advised to be vigilant about attending to problems such as leaking faucets and insufficient drainage, as moist soil conditions can draw termites to their home. Keeping subfloor air vents free from blockages is a simple yet reliable strategy for preventing termite problems.
